OGLinter - Real-Time Orthographic-Grammar Linter for Minecraft

OGLinter is a client-side mod that adds real-time grammar and spelling suggestions while you type in the Minecraft chat. It helps you write cleaner, clearer, and more correct messages, without leaving the game.


Features

  • Grammar and spelling detection powered by LanguageTool

  • Supports French (🇫🇷) but more in the future !

  • Two modes of operation for any PC configuration:

    • Real-time mode: checks the entire input live as you type
    • After-word mode: only checks the full input after you finish typing a word.
  • Ignore list system so you can exclude certain words from checks

  • Suggestions appear directly below the underlined word

  • Click on a suggestion to instantly replace the word

  • Works entirely client-side (does not require any internet connexion)


Language Support

Currently, the mod supports French only (fr-FR). More languages may be added in future versions.


Commands

You can control the linter by using commands in the chat:

/og toggle

Toggle the linter on or off.

/og mode <real_time | after_word>

Change the analysis mode:

  • real_time: checks while typing
  • after_word: checks only after a word is completed

/og dico add <word>

Add a word to the ignore list (it will no longer be checked or underlined).

/og dico remove <word>

Remove a word from the ignore list.

/og dico list

View all currently ignored words.


Requirements

  • Minecraft 1.21.7 or 1.21.8
  • Fabric Loader
  • Java 21
